Ministry Receives Bali Top Hospitality Leader in Religious Tourism Development
- 16 Sep 2026 14:43 WIB
- Voice of Indonesia
RRI.CO.ID, Sanur — Indonesia's Minister of Religious Affairs, Nasaruddin Umar, received the "Bali Top Hospitality Leader in Religious Tourism Development" award from the Indonesia Travel & Tourism Awards (ITTA) Foundation. The award was presented during the 11th Bali Tourism Awards 2026 held in Sanur, Bali, in recognition of the Minister's role in developing religious tourism in the country.
The award was presented during a ceremony in Sanur on Monday, September 14, 2026. As the Minister was unable to attend in person, the award was accepted on his behalf by the Special Staff for Religious Harmony, Gugun Gumilar. "Last night, I represented the Minister of Religious Affairs in accepting the 'Bali Top Hospitality Leader in Religious Tourism Development' award from the Indonesia Travel & Tourism Awards (ITTA) Foundation," said Gugun Gumilar in Sanur.
Gugun explained that the award recognizes the Minister's contributions to advancing religious tourism, particularly in Bali. "This award serves as recognition of the Minister of Religious Affairs' contribution to developing and advancing religious tourism, especially in Bali," he stated.
According to him, the ITTA Foundation regularly honors figures, institutions, and leaders deemed to have made tangible contributions to the progress of the national tourism industry. The category awarded to the Minister this time honors his leadership, dedication, and contributions to fostering the development of religious tourism in Indonesia.
Furthermore, Gugun noted that the award also acknowledges efforts to strengthen the potential of religious and cultural tourism. "This includes strengthening the potential of religious and cultural tourism, particularly in supporting the development of Hindu religious tourism destinations as well as religious tourism potential across various faiths in Indonesia," he said.
Gugun added that the growth of religious tourism in various regions, including Bali, is inseparable from the collaborative efforts of the government and religious communities to maintain harmony and strengthen religious moderation. He cited the religious harmony index achieved in 2025 as concrete evidence of the success of these efforts. "We all recognize that since the harmony index survey was first conducted, 2025 has recorded the highest index score. This is an extraordinary achievement," he said.
He emphasized that harmony serves as a crucial foundation for development across various sectors, including religious tourism. "Harmony is a prerequisite for development. Therefore, it impacts not only the growth of religious tourism but also other development sectors," he asserted.
The award presentation ceremony was attended by regional leaders, ambassadors from friendly nations, heads of tourism associations, academics, industry players, investors, national media representatives, and executives from the travel, hospitality, aviation, destination management, and creative economy sectors.
